Ireneusz Fąfara
President of the management Boards and Managing Director at Orlen S.A.
An expert with in-depth knowledge of the fuel sector and the challenges related to the energy transition. A practitioner in managing large organizations and multibillion-dollar projects.
From 2010 to 2017, he was associated with the ORLEN Group. As the CEO of ORLEN Lietuva, he reformed and made the refinery in Mažeikiai profitable. He negotiated agreements and resolved long-standing disputes related to logistics. He significantly increased ORLEN Lietuva’s sales in export markets. He has expertise in the specifics of the ORLEN Group and the processes occurring within it.
Since the late 1990s, he has held senior management positions in large public and private companies.
Member of supervisory boards: Rockbridge TFI (2018-2024, resigned upon appointment as President of ORLEN S.A.), PKO BP (2009-2010), LOTOS (2009-2010), Export Credit Insurance Corporation (2007-2009), Kompania Węglowa (2003-2005), National Health Fund (2005-2008), Energy Market Agency (1997-1998).
CEO of the Bank Gospodarstwa Krajowego (2007-2009) and Vice-President of the Social Insurance Institution (1998-2007). Graduate of the Cracow University of Economics.
He holds a degree from the Cracow University of Economics in International Economic Relations and completed postgraduate studies at the Łódź University of Technology. He has completed internships at the stock exchanges in Frankfurt and Düsseldorf. He has also attended finance, capital markets, and pension system courses, organized by institutions such as the Swiss Bankers Association and the Austrian National Bank. He holds a securities broker license.

Grzegorz Jóźwiak
Director, Hydrogen Technologies and Synthetic Fuels Department, ORLEN S.A.
Grzegorz has 20 years’ experience in segment of refinery, petrochemical and fertilizers production. He has deep and broad experience in low carbon solutions from an operational and optimization point of view. Years of successful experience in teams management with deliverables results. Responsible for the implementation of the hydrogen strategy at ORLEN Group. He has created totally new hydrogen business line with state of the art hydrogen Dream Team. He has initiated and launched the first Hydrogen Academy for students in Poland. He coordinated the processes of receiving non-repayable funding from European programs such as Connecting Europe Facility (CEF), Important Projects of Common European Interest (IPCEI). He is a NATO Civil Expert in Energy Planning Group, Member of the Clean Hydrogen Partnership Governing Board, Member of the Coordination Board of the Sectoral Agreement for the Development of the Hydrogen Economy in Poland, Member of the Program Council of the Hydrogen Technologies Center at the Gdańsk University of Technology. He has graduated of the Warsaw University of Technology and has completed the Executive MBA postgraduate program with distinction.

Marek Garniewski
President of the Management Board ORLEN VC
Manager associated with the capital market for more than a dozen years, he gained experience in banks and investment funds. In ORLEN Capital Group involved in the area of Strategy and Innovation and Investor Relations. Since 2021, he has been responsible for the development and management of one of the largest Corporate Venture Capital funds in CEE - ORLEN VC, investing in such areas as energy, circular economy, new mobility, advanced materials, retail of the future, industry digitalization or alternative fuels.
